We are seeking a Senior Product Analyst to support the definition and delivery of the Optum Point of Care experience, including provider-facing workflows embedded within leading EHR platforms. This role will partner closely with product leaders, design, engineering, technical integration, analytics, and implementation teams to translate product direction and clinical workflows into clear requirements and delivery-ready work.
This is a product role first, with an added emphasis on product operations, process improvement, and program management skills. The successful candidate will help keep product work moving through solid requirements, backlog readiness, dependency management, status reporting, and launch readiness, while also helping the team build lightweight and repeatable operating processes.
Optum Point of Care is designed to bring together AI-driven capabilities such as ambient documentation, chart intelligence, autonomous coding, and provider billing to help reduce administrative burden, improve documentation quality, and support more connected clinical and revenue cycle workflows.
In this role, you must be able to communicate complex concepts clearly with product, technical, operational, and leadership stakeholders. You should be organized, curious, comfortable working through ambiguity, and able to balance independent execution with close cross-functional collaboration.

Primary Responsibilities:
- Translate product strategy and workflow needs into clear requirements, user stories, delivery plans, milestones, and measurable outcomes
- Support the definition and delivery of provider-facing Optum Point of Care workflows embedded within EHR platforms, in partnership with product, design, engineering, and technical integration teams
- Develop an understanding of provider behaviour and clinical workflows to identify opportunities to reduce friction, improve usability, and support provider productivity
- Maintain backlog readiness and help ensure product work is clearly defined, prioritized, traceable to intended outcomes, and ready for delivery
- Coordinate dependencies, risks, decisions, and follow-up across cross-functional teams to support product execution, pilot and launch readiness
- Build and improve lightweight product operating processes, including intake, roadmap tracking, status reporting, dependency management, and readiness coordination
- Apply practical AI-enabled approaches across the product development lifecycle, including discovery, analysis, requirements, documentation, and quality checks, while following applicable governance processes
